Population change in Saint Petersburg, 2016. Source: Rosstat.

Population change in Saint Petersburg in 2016: 1.1 %.

Change versus 2015: +0.4 % (indicator rose by 57.1%).

Place among Russian regions

In 2016, Saint Petersburg is among the ten regions with the largest values among 85 federal subjects (full regional ranking).

Comparison with the Russian average

The Russian average in 2016 was 0.2 %. The region's value is above the national average.
